If you've ever driven through Indian highways, dusty construction zones, mining routes, or long rural stretches, you know what we’re talking about. The dust isn’t just a nuisance. It is constantly trying to enter your engine.
Your engine needs clean air to breathe, just like we do. Every kilometre you travel, fine particles attempt to pass through your filtration system. When they succeed, they begin wearing down internal components, cylinder walls, piston rings, and even affecting oil quality. You may not notice the impact immediately, but over time it leads to higher maintenance frequency and rising costs.
A clogged filter creates another problem. It restricts airflow and disrupts the air-to-fuel ratio. The engine works harder to deliver the same output, which increases fuel consumption. Across long-haul routes, small inefficiencies quickly translate into measurable expense.

What to Look for in an Air Filter
- Filtration efficiency is the first priority. The filter must capture fine dust particles, especially silica, without restricting airflow. Achieving that balance protects engine components while maintaining steady combustion.
- Dust-holding capacity is equally important. Heavy-duty trucks cover long distances between service intervals. A filter with higher capacity sustains airflow for longer periods, reducing replacement frequency and minimizing downtime.
- Fitment matters more than many assume. Each engine has defined airflow requirements and housing dimensions. An improper seal allows unfiltered air to bypass the media entirely. The right fit ensures the entire intake system performs as intended.
- Durability is another key factor. Reliable Industrial Air Filters are built to withstand vibration, load stress, and temperature fluctuations common in heavy-duty operations. Stable construction ensures consistent filtration even under demanding conditions.

Warning Signs You Shouldn't Ignore
Your truck typically signals when filtration performance declines. Sluggish pickup during acceleration often points to restricted airflow. Black smoke under throttle may indicate incomplete combustion. Rising fuel consumption without changes in route or payload is another clear warning sign.
Ignoring these symptoms increases the risk of internal engine wear and higher repair costs. Regular inspection of the intake system, along with timely replacement, prevents larger mechanical issues.

The Real Cost of “Cheap” Filters
For fleet managers, lower upfront prices can be tempting. However, basic filters often offer lower filtration efficiency and limited dust-holding capacity. They may require more frequent replacement and expose engines to higher contamination risk.
High-performance filters typically last longer and provide stronger protection. Stable airflow supports efficient combustion and better fuel economy. Over time, the savings in reduced fuel usage and fewer maintenance events often outweigh the initial difference in price.
